Here’s what you need to know.Cynthia Marie Rodgers, 59, graduated from Capital Law School and intended to become a lawyer in Ohio. As part of her bar admission, she was required to pass a character and fitness review, which is typical for aspiring lawyers to ensure they have good character to practice law.that her bar admission be denied. The reason? The Court said Rogers did not have the requisite character or fitness to practice law.
Rodgers told the Court she is disabled and only can work part-time. She is enrolled in an income-driven repayment plan, which enables her pay a monthly student loan payment based on her discretionary income. Rodgers told the Court that she expects that her loans will either be forgiven or she will pay for the remainder of her life.
Not exactly. Naturally, most recent law school graduates have student loan debt when they apply for bar admission. If student loans alone would disqualify a prospective lawyer, then many new law school graduates would not become members of a state bar. That said, fitness and moral character are important components for bar admission. While student loans in isolation may not disqualify an applicant, state bars can evaluate the totality of the circumstances to reach an overall judgment on an applicant’s moral character. In this case, the Court believed that Rodgers misused the legal system by filing numerous lawsuits.
